The sensory garden at Larne Museum, appealing to all the senses through colour, scent, sound, taste and touch, was designed by local garden designer and artist, Dawn Aston in 2008. Local primary schools, St Anthony’s, Larne & Inver and Linn, helped to plant the flower beds and planters. The garden includes aromatic plants, such as lavender and thyme, along with tactile ornamental grasses.
